Story Behind the Curve
The Office of Highway Safety Planning (OHSP) provides car seats free of charge to MCHD for distribution in the community. Car seats must be inspected and installed with a certified Child Passenger Safety Technician and must include use of a checklist work sheet. Seats are provided to children and families enrolled in a social service program with presestablished income guidelines (WIC, Head Start, etc). A referral process is utilized to identify clients in need and appointments are scheduled at events in the community to meet with the clients. There is a one seat per child lifetime rule to ensure as many children and families are impacted by the program as possible
